Proclinical is advertising a vacancy for a Strategic Account Manager position with an internationally leading scientific information company. This global organisation of expert scientists, technologists, and business leaders, which has a long and successful history of harnessing scientific information opportunities to provide market-leading products and custom solutions tailored to client specific needs, is seeking for the Strategic Account Manager to join their UK team in a home-based capacity.
The Strategic Account Manager will be accountable for profitable achievement of sales objectives for new sales and existing accounts in an assigned territory. They will identify new customer opportunities, track selling activities, manage contact information for sales prospects, whilst delivering sales presentations and partnering with field sales and marketing functions to develop marketing plans. They will also ensure that organisational products meet client needs and prepare territory reports. Finally, the Strategic Account Manager will recommend products or service enhancements to improve customer satisfaction and sales potential.
Job Responsibilities:
- Managing all aspects of assigned Strategic Accounts, including overall relationship management, cross-selling, upselling, retention, conflict-resolution, and overall client satisfaction.
- Focusing on increasing Annual Contract Value (ACV) of assigned Strategic accounts through developing relationships which are both deeper and wider, whilst engaging with all cross-functional and business unit key decision makers and influencers
- Collaborating closely with Senior Customer Success Managers assigned to their accounts to ensure existing revenues are retained and that users, decision makers, and influencers are realising the full value of company solutions.
- Identifying areas for the company to best align to client's needs and strategic direction so that future growth opportunities are proactively identified and captured.
- Following a well-defined sales process, keeping CRM tool up-to-date and reflective of opportunity status.
- Aligning to the most influential Personas within the client organization to build consensus across the buying decision team to improve company success rate.
- Understanding the unique strategy of each of their assigned accounts and how the company can best align our products and service in support of that strategy.
- Acting as a subject matter expert in assigned account verticals and sub-verticals, market dynamics, and their competitive set which influence current and future account strategy and performance.
- Conducting sales calls to meet face-to-face with key decision makers to uncover unmet needs, identify opportunities for growth, and align with the client's strategic objectives.
- Working closely with the Senior Customer Success Managers to ensure the customer recognises the value of company products and services that goes beyond pricing.
- Collaborating with company peers across the globe to ensure a cohesive, well communicated approach is taken in working with the client - building a consensus internally and externally to drive a unified face to the client that will result in exceptional customer engagement and satisfaction.
- Managing their pipeline, forecast, and deal desk calls related to their assigned clients to develop a strategy and align resources that will increase their chances of closing incremental business.
- Managing key relationships across the entire business decision team and user groups at the account, ensuring advocacy and trust.
- Regularly conducting Business Reviews (minimum 2X / year) that result in greater strategic alignment and a focus on shared results orientation.
- Delivering insights to the customer that cause client decision makers and influencers to consider the company as their trusted partner driven to support their measurable business objectives.
- Strives to create compelling ROI / Value propositions specific to the client's needs and resulting in improved business expansion
Skills and Requirements:
- A Bachelor's Degree in Chemistry, Business, or Communications fields, or a rich history with chemical applications.
- At least eight years of sales related experience in a global capacity across multiple theaters and cultures including lead generation, inside and outside sales, business development, and strategic accounts.
- Proven ability to increase bookings and annual contract value in portfolio of strategic accounts.
- Three or more years of experience with CRM software.
- Demonstrable experience with virtual selling tools such as GoToMeeting, Web-Ex, or other comparable tools.
- Experience leveraging LinkedIn and other prospecting tools.
- Good interpersonal skills, including communication, presentation, persuasion, and influence.
- Good organisational skills, including efficiency, punctuality, and collaboration in a team environment.
- Proficiency with computer skills, such as MS Office.
- Mid-Senior Level.
